We scrutinise Andy Farrell's (conservative) first selection as Irish coach, discussing the virtues of experience and "experimentation". We preview Le Crunch: Eddie Jones promises withering physicality for the French who, with their glittering youthful talent, promise a return to the days when they ruled the championship along with Les Rosbifs.Finally we talk briefly about Wales and Italy. Five of the six coaches are new but Gatland casts the longest shadow of all those departing. How will Wales cope? And should Italy just embrace La Brutta Vita?
